Output 26e881784bcd803377ea924dcd5febbdc0bfba10ec075e0899482c97ff62d571:19

value
617812
script pubkey
OP_0 OP_PUSHBYTES_20 967938c107605462fb509d87ed0886b3fd28aa11
address
bc1qjeun3sg8vp2x976snkr76zyxk07j32s3dty9qk
transaction
26e881784bcd803377ea924dcd5febbdc0bfba10ec075e0899482c97ff62d571
spent
true